Description: Forest River Aurora travel trailer 26FKDS highlights: Rear Master Bedroom Two Pantries Booth Dinette Front Kitchen 18' Awning Double Entry Doors You're going to love every minute spent in this travel trailer with double slide outs and double entry doors.
The front kitchen includes ample counter space to prep and cook meals, plus
there are two pantries for storage space. Your crew can get comfortable on the 70" sofa or play a game at the booth dinette. There is also an entertainment center with a 39" flat screen LED TV for movie night, or you might head outdoors to relax under the 18' awning.
The exterior camper kitchen here includes a griddle and a mini refrigerator the chef of your group is sure to love. When it's time to call it a night, head to the rear master bedroom that includes a queen bed slide out, a large wardrobe, plus your own entrance into the dual entry bath! Comfortability, usability, and quality is what you will find in each one of these Forest River Aurora travel trailers or toy haulers!
They are designed with a superior build and packed full with industry leading, functional, and distinctive standard features. Solid Step entrance steps and an XL swing arm grab handle help you to safely enter and exit the unit.
The diamond plate rock guard will protect your unit from road debris and the nitrogen filled radial tires , which keep their pressure longer, offer better fuel economy. You will also find upgraded JBL Elite exterior speakers outside, a Carefree awning with multicolor lights and remote , plus flush mount baggage doors for easy packing. The interiors are beautifully designed with a deep undermount farm style sink, stainless steel appliances , and linoleum flooring throughout which will be easy to clean. Cheyenne Newly remodeled 2 bedroom upstairs apartment overlooking the bustling City of Cheyenne.
Located in downtown Cheyenne near the Plaza, restaurants, shopping and the Cheyenne Frontier Days parade route. This is a very special place to be located. The downtown has come alive with music venues, theater, museums, restaurants and so much more.
Everything in the apartment is new; floors, fixtures, paint, closets, bathroom, kitchen and bedroom. It was redone from one end to the other yet is located in the historic district of Cheyenne. Sorry no animals, $1200 monthly rent, $1200 damage deposit, annual lease.
Washer/Dryer located in the unit. Utilities included except cable/internet. There is also an additional common area available to sit and enjoy more views and a breeze.
